Comprehensive Guide to Employment Application

What is the Application for Employment?

The Application for Employment is a crucial document in the job application process, serving to collect essential personal and professional information from job seekers. This form allows applicants to provide key details such as their name, address, and employment history, which are vital for potential employers to evaluate candidates effectively.
Employers utilize the application form to assess qualifications and make informed hiring decisions. By standardizing the information provided, the form helps streamline the application process for both applicants and employers.

Common Errors to Avoid When Completing the Application

To minimize errors during application completion, applicants should be aware of common pitfalls. Frequent mistakes include leaving sections incomplete or misspelling names and contact information.
Double-checking all dates and the accuracy of personal data is essential. Additionally, make sure that all required information is provided, as this can significantly impact the application's success.

Submitting Your Application for Employment

Submitting your application can occur through multiple channels, including online, in-person, or by mail. Each submission method may have specific deadlines or timelines that applicants need to adhere to.
Keeping copies of submitted applications for your records is advisable, as this can assist in follow-ups and future applications.

Typically, anyone seeking employment can fill out the Application for Employment; however, applicants must be at least 18 years old, as indicated in the certification section of the form.
Deadlines for submitting the application can vary by employer. It is advisable to submit your application as soon as possible to ensure consideration for any open positions.
You can submit the completed Application for Employment either by downloading and printing the form to mail it or electronically submitting it through the employer's designated application portal if available.
While not always required, you may want to include a resume, cover letter, and any certifications relevant to the position when submitting your application.
Common mistakes include providing incomplete or inaccurate information, neglecting to sign the form, and failing to double-check for spelling errors that could affect your application.
Processing times for applications vary by employer. Typically, applicants can expect feedback within one to two weeks after submission, but this can depend on the employer's hiring process.
